Aerodynamic Design and Weight Reduction
The vehicle’s aerodynamic design and overall weight also play a crucial role in determining fuel efficiency. Streamlined body shapes and optimized airflow can reduce drag, minimizing the energy required to propel the vehicle at higher speeds. Similarly, weight reduction through the use of lightweight materials, such as aluminum or carbon fiber, can improve fuel economy by reducing the overall mass the engine needs to move. These design elements contribute to lower fuel consumption across various driving conditions.

Driving Conditions and Driver Behavior
Fuel efficiency estimates are typically provided for city, highway, and combined driving conditions. However, real-world fuel economy can vary significantly based on individual driving habits and external factors. Aggressive acceleration, frequent braking, and high-speed driving can all negatively impact fuel efficiency. Similarly, driving in congested traffic or hilly terrain can increase fuel consumption. For example, a driver who consistently accelerates rapidly and drives at high speeds may experience lower MPG figures than those achieved in standardized testing conditions. Therefore, fuel efficiency estimates serve as a guideline, and actual results may vary.

Regulatory Standards and Testing Procedures
Fuel efficiency estimates are determined through standardized testing procedures mandated by regulatory agencies, such as the Environmental Protection Agency (EPA) in the United States. These tests simulate various driving conditions to provide a consistent and comparable measure of fuel consumption across different vehicles. The 2025 CLA 250’s fuel efficiency estimates will be subject to these testing procedures, ensuring that consumers receive accurate and reliable information. However, it is important to note that these tests may not perfectly reflect real-world driving conditions, and consumers should consider their individual driving habits when interpreting these estimates.

Question 1: What is the anticipated horsepower output of the 2025 CLA 250 engine?
The exact horsepower output for the 2025 CLA 250 engine has not been officially released. However, industry expectations suggest a modest increase over the previous model year, potentially reaching approximately 221 horsepower. Confirmation awaits official manufacturer specifications.
Question 2: Will the 2025 CLA 250 be available with all-wheel drive?
While front-wheel drive is anticipated to remain the standard configuration, an all-wheel drive (4MATIC) system is expected to be offered as an optional upgrade. This enhances traction and stability, particularly in inclement weather conditions.
Question 3: Are there expected to be significant exterior design changes compared to the 2024 model?
Substantial deviations from the existing design language are not anticipated. Instead, expect subtle refinements to the front fascia, rear bumper, and wheel designs. These adjustments aim to maintain the vehicle’s contemporary aesthetic while incorporating minor stylistic updates.
Question 4: What is the expected starting price for the 2025 CLA 250?
An exact starting price remains undisclosed. However, based on historical trends and market analysis, a slight increase over the previous model year’s base price is projected. A starting price in the range of $44,000 to $46,000 is a reasonable estimate.
